'54 Quintets Open 1st Winter's Intramurals

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Yardling intramural basketball opened last night with four games in the American League. National League competition will get underway tonight.

In the first game of the evening, a well-balanced Matthews North team defeated Stoughton, 21 to 19. Al Aaron and "C.J." Clark tied for Matthews scoring honors with six points. Straus North won, 12 to 4, against Thayer South.

Norm Hall scored the shot that gave Thayer Middle a 21 to 18 win over Holworthy. Wigglesworth East, aided by John Griner's ten points, took Weld South, 22 to 19. Lionel was inactive, after drawing a bye.

Stoughton, at the beginning of the basketball season, is leading in the Yard intramurals.
